Decision of Supreme Court on Bahria Town welcomed by the industry

Islamabad: Supreme Court’s (SC) decision of accepting Bahria Town’s offer to pay Rs.460 billion has been welcomed by a large number of real estate agents, builders and various other stakeholders including allottees of Bahria Town Rawalpindi, Karachi and Lahore.

The order by SC has rekindled hopes of allied industries inclusive of cement factories and brick kiln owners preparing for an increased production. Industrialists, builders, developers and Bahria Town allottees across the country has welcomed SC’s decision as a step towards national development.
